Turning up the heat!

Just got of the phone with Jeff Brooks.

Faxpc.com – A news release will be issued 5 minutes before it goes live. Beta testing is in progress but they have decided that the market has attached a great deal of significance to the launch therefore they will issue a NR just before the launch to avoid any bets being hedged on timing.
Efax – normally a 6 to 8 week time line is involved in testing. Technical discussions are take place between the companies but discussions on the deal will not happen until all testing is complete. The testing started on March 23 thus May 23 could be roughly the date where efax has completed all their testing.

JBIG2 – 100% of all resolutions of the standard so far have been passed. It is highly anticipated that the deal is done. Historically this is the normal practice. Can't say absolutely 100% but it would be very irregular that years of work would be scrubbed for any departure of the standard that has been worked towards.

The complexities of the JBIG2 standard require that only Masters students and PHD types can participate in the theoretical research. Again IPZ has the only working JBIG2 encoder/decoder. Their lead researcher is head of the Canadian delegation of the ISO committee. The July standards meeting is going to be a very big event and meaningful to the industry.
